Feature foraine fraise
Definition Entrepreneuse de spectacles et jeux divers sur les fêtes foraines. Faux-fruit du fraisier, réceptacle charnu de forme ovoïde oblongue plus ou moins arrondie et de couleur rouge à maturité (les « fruits » véritables au sens botanique sont les akènes qui recouvrent la peau de la fraise).
